Research Group Leader

Dr. Martha Havenith

Ernst-Strüngmann Institute for Neuroscience

Martha Havenith is a Max Planck research group leader at the Ernst-Strüngmann Institute for Neuroscience, where she uses virtual-reality tasks to explore the brain’s astonishing ability to juggle multiple ongoing cognitive processes in the same group of neurons. Her previous career milestones include an M.Sc. at Oxford University, a Ph.D. at the Max-Planck Institute for Brain Research (Frankfurt), and post-doctoral fellowships at University College London and the Donders Institute for Brain, Cognition and Behaviour (Nijmegen). She is also a certified facilitator for Connective Breathwork. In that capacity, she regularly facilitates breathwork sessions for individuals and small groups, as well as leading facilitator trainings.
